A parliamentary panel has reported that persistent delays in NCERT textbook distribution and a shift toward application-based exams have significantly widened the curriculum gap for students.

2

The report highlights that schools are struggling to complete the syllabus on time, leading to increased reliance on private coaching centers for core subjects.

3

The committee has recommended an immediate overhaul of the distribution logistics and a review of the exam pattern to ensure equitable access to learning materials.
